是否可以在 Google 计算引擎实例中指定 mac 地址;我正在移动一个旧版 Java 软件,该软件的许可证已绑定到 Mac 的 eth0。操作系统现在是 centos7。我尝试使用 ifconfig,但失去了连接
答案1
Google 支持:[...] 我可以确认,目前无法更改主界面的 MAC 地址。我们有功能请求,使 MAC 地址可配置,也可以在 API 中简单地显示 MAC 地址。[...]
答案2
我没有使用 GCE 的具体经验,但了解虚拟化后,我怀疑这是否可行。MAC 地址是 NIC 的硬件地址,在虚拟机上是在操作系统之外的虚拟机配置中指定的。当您将 ifcfg 文件更改为具有不同的 MAC 地址时,它会尝试将该配置绑定到具有该地址的设备,但当然找不到匹配的设备,因此失败了。